With a population of 18,659, Steubenville is a must-see destination in Ohio, United States.
Looking for warm weather? Then head to Steubenville in July, when the average temperature is 23 °C, and the highest can go up to 29 °C. The coldest month, on the other hand, is January, when it can get as cold as -6 °C, with an average temperature of -2 °C. You’re likely to see more rain in July, when precipitation is around 108 mm. In contrast, February is usually the driest month of the year in Steubenville, with an average rainfall of 62 mm.
